Vue实现多页应用的3种方式·项目·配置Webpack来处理这些模板文件

Vue实现多页应用的3种方式

一、使用Vue CLI的多页面配置

Vue CLI让创建多页面应用变得超级简单,你只需要按照以下步骤操作:

  1. 创建Vue项目:在命令行中运行 vue create my-project
  2. 在项目根目录下创建文件并进行多页面配置。
  3. 创建对应的入口文件和模板文件。
  4. main.js 中配置相应的Vue实例。
  5. 启动项目:在命令行中运行 npm run serve

二、手动配置多个HTML模板

手动配置多个HTML模板可以给你更多的自由度,具体步骤如下:

  1. 在项目根目录下创建多个HTML模板文件,比如 page1.htmlpage2.html
  2. 配置Webpack来处理这些模板文件。在 webpack.config.js 中添加多页面配置。
  3. 创建对应的入口文件:在 src 目录下创建 page1.jspage2.js
  4. 配置相应的Vue实例并启动项目。

三、使用第三方插件或框架

除了手动配置,你还可以使用第三方插件或框架来简化配置过程。比如使用 vue-router 插件:

  1. 安装插件:在命令行中运行 npm install vue-router
  2. 在项目根目录下创建文件,并进行配置。
  3. 创建对应的入口文件和模板文件,并配置相应的Vue实例。

通过以上三种方法,你可以有效地实现Vue多页应用。选择哪种方法取决于你的项目需求和开发经验。Vue CLI的多页面配置是最简单且推荐的方式,而手动配置和使用第三方插件则提供了更高的灵活性。

相关问答FAQs

1. 什么是Vue多页应用?

Vue多页应用就是用Vue框架构建的,由多个HTML页面组成的程序。每个页面都有自己的Vue实例,可以独立加载和渲染,不需要像单页应用那样通过路由切换页面。

2. 如何创建Vue多页应用?

创建Vue多页应用的步骤包括:确保安装了Vue CLI,使用Vue CLI创建项目,选择多页模式配置,然后按照提示完成配置。

3. 如何在Vue多页应用中进行页面间的跳转?

在Vue多页应用中,页面间的跳转是通过超链接实现的。你可以在HTML文件中使用相对路径来指定跳转的目标页面。如果需要传递数据,可以使用URL参数或表单提交等方式,并在目标页面中通过JavaScript或Vue实例获取这些数据。